Summary
Childhood mesial temporal lobe epilepsy (MTLE) often begins with prolonged seizures. Many cases are intractable, with limited seizure control and few candidates for epilepsy surgery.

Background:
- Mesial temporal lobe epilepsy (MTLE) is a common focal epilepsy syndrome.
- Understanding childhood-onset MTLE is crucial for early diagnosis and management.
- Previous studies have not fully elucidated the clinical spectrum of pediatric MTLE.
Purpose of the Study:
- To define the clinical, electroencephalographic, and neuroradiologic features of childhood-onset mesial temporal lobe epilepsy (MTLE).
- To investigate the initial seizure types, presumed causes, and clinical course of pediatric MTLE.
- To assess the progression of mesial temporal sclerosis (MTS) and treatment outcomes in this population.
Main Methods:
- A retrospective study of 19 pediatric patients diagnosed with MTLE.
- Clinical data collection including seizure history and preceding events.
- Electroencephalography (EEG) and magnetic resonance imaging (MRI) for neuroradiologic assessment.
Main Results:
- MTLE represented 0.82% of childhood-onset epilepsy cases.
- Initial seizures included febrile convulsions, generalized convulsions, and complex partial seizures (CPS).
- Prolonged convulsions (>30 min) were identified in 63.2% of cases; 10.5% achieved >6 months seizure control, while 21.1% were candidates for surgery.
Conclusions:
- Childhood MTLE presents with diverse seizure types and variable clinical courses.
- Mesial temporal sclerosis (MTS) may develop rapidly, even before age 5.
- Pediatric MTLE is often intractable, highlighting the need for advanced treatment strategies.
